I believe MUDs might be a relatively low resource intensive game server to host. For those who aren't familiar with them, they are basically text based games that people can play on. There is a pretty large community of this type of gamers that can be found over the net.
As far as resources go, a small one wouldn't even take up a few megabytes of space, and depending on how efficient the code is, probably a smaller amount of RAM and much less CPU power would be needed.
